We detect you are using an unsupported browser. For the best experience, please visit the site using Chrome, Firefox, Safari, or Edge. X

Live Chat

Need Help?

Privacy Policy

IEC 61508 Functional Safety Readiness With FPGAs


We are committed to providing you with FPGAs that you can successfully use in safety-critical designs. New technology brings new ways for a system containing electronics or programmable electronics to fail. Failures can cause harm to people and property and although it is impossible to guarantee a technological system will never fail, it is possible to reduce the risk of failure and to design systems so that if they do fail, they fail safely.

IEC 61508 Compliance


IEC 61508 requirements are extensive. They ensure that functional safety is considered and accounted for in all aspects of the program for the entire lifecycle of the product. The image below illustrates the overall lifecycle required by the IEC61508. The depth and rigor of the requirements depend on the Safety Integrity Level (SIL) of the safety-related functions involved.

V-Model Development 


Most often, FPGAs are components in a much more complicated system. IEC 61508 requires the use of a V-model for development that describes the sequence of verification and validation activities. Our V-model is shown below:                        

Timeline Reduction for Functional Safety 


We provide a complete ecosystem based on robust design flows that includes supporting documentation, IPs, certification and more to minimize risks for customers and reduce time to market.                        

Benefits of Our Low-Power FPGAs


Most Power-Efficient FPGAs

Two Times More Performance Per Watt

Exceptional Reliability

Zero Configuration Upsets

Military-Grade Security

Best Cyber and Anti-Tamper Security

FPGA Functional Safety Portfolio


Our functional safety design flow simplifies and accelerates safety certifications supporting IEC61508. Our Flash FPGAs are an ideal platform to meet the established standards for safety and reliability requirements. You can use the following FPGA families with Libero® SoC Design Suite for compliance with IEC61508 up to SIL 3.

FPGA Family Libero® SoC Design Suite Availability Ordering
SmartFusion® 2 FPGAs Libero SoC Design Suite Version 11.8 SP4

Available

SAFETY-PKG-M2S-M2GL-F (Floating License)
SAFETY-PKG-M2S-M2GL-NL (Node Lock Licence)
(20 years Gold Archival license)
IGLOO® 2 FPGAs
ProASIC® 3 FPGAs Libero SoC Design Suite Version 11.5 SP2 Available SAFETY-PKG-G3 With Floating License
SAFETY-PKG-G3 With Node Lock License
(20 years Gold Archival license)
ProASIC 3E FPGAs
ProASIC 3L FPGAs
ProASIC 3 Nano FPGAs
IGLOO FPGAs
IGLOO nano FPGAs
IGLOO Plus FPGAs
SmartFusion FPGAs

We designed the functional safety packet to assist with IEC 61508 certification. It includes:

  • Libero SoC Design Suite certified by TÜV SÜD
  • Functional safety user guide
  • FPGA and SoC products reliability report
  • Libero SoC Design Suite documentation
  • Relevant IP cores and associated documentation

Need Some Help?


We are here to support you. Contact us at FPGA_FunctionalSafety@microchip.com if you have any questions about functional safety with FPGAs.